Common Misconceptions
1. The Content Within This Application is Directly Generated by the Website
One common misconception is that the content displayed within this application is directly generated by the associated website. However, this is not always the case. While some applications may pull content directly from the website, others might obtain and display the content in different ways.
- The application may use an API to access specific data from the website.
- The content could be pre-configured and stored within the application itself.
- In some cases, the application may show only a subset of the website’s content.
2. All the Information Displayed in the Application is Accurate and Updated
Another misconception is that all the information displayed within this application is accurate and updated in real-time. While the application might strive to provide the most recent content, there are factors that could affect the accuracy and timeliness of the displayed information.
- The application’s data might be cached and not immediately refreshed from the website.
- Changes made to the website might not always reflect instantly in the application.
- Some applications may rely on scheduled updates to pull new content from the website.
3. The Application Mirrors the Entire Website’s Structure and Content
It is commonly assumed that the application mirrors the entire structure and content of the associated website. However, this is not always the case, as the application may selectively choose which parts of the website’s content to display.
- Only certain sections or pages of the website may be relevant to the application’s purpose.
- The application might aggregate content from multiple sources, not limited to the associated website.
- Some functionality of the website may be intentionally omitted or modified in the application for a better user experience.
4. The Application Automatically Updates Based on Changes in the Website
Many people believe that this application will automatically update its content whenever changes are made on the associated website. While some applications may have such functionality, it is not a universal feature.
- The application may require manual synchronization or refreshing to reflect the latest changes on the website.
- The website might have a separate application programming interface (API) that needs to be integrated with the application to get real-time updates.
- Changes made on the website might not always be relevant or necessary for the application’s purpose.
5. The Website Controls the Functionality and Design of the Application
Finally, people often assume that the website has complete control over the functionality and design of the associated application. While the website may influence certain aspects, the application itself can have its own unique features and design elements.
- The application may have additional functionality not available on the website.
- The design of the application might be optimized for a specific platform or device.
- The website’s branding and style might be adapted but not necessarily replicated in the application.

Q: What does ‘Content Within This Application Coming From the Website’ mean?
A: This phrase refers to any content that is being retrieved from a website and displayed within a specific application. It could be text, images, videos, or any other form of media that is embedded or linked to from the website.
Q: How can I find out where the content within the application is coming from?
A: To identify the source of the content within an application, you can check the website title or domain from where the content is being loaded. This information is usually displayed in the application’s user interface or provided in the application’s documentation.
Q: What are the benefits of displaying content within an application from a website?
A: Displaying content within an application from a website allows for easy integration of up-to-date information and dynamic content without the need to manually update the application. It also provides a seamless user experience by presenting content from trusted and established sources.
Q: Are there any security concerns when displaying external content within an application?
A: Yes, there can be security concerns when displaying external content within an application. It is important to ensure that the content being loaded is from reliable sources and that appropriate security measures are in place to prevent any potential vulnerabilities or attacks.
Q: Can I control the styling of the content within an application?
A: In most cases, the styling of the content within an application is controlled by the website from where the content is being loaded. However, depending on the application’s capabilities, you may be able to apply some additional styling or customization to the content within the application.
Q: What happens if the website from where the content is loaded becomes unavailable?
A: If the website from where the content is loaded becomes unavailable, the content within the application may not be displayed correctly or at all. It is important to handle such scenarios gracefully and provide appropriate error handling or fallback options to ensure a good user experience.
Q: Is it legal to display content from another website within an application?
A: The legality of displaying content from another website within an application depends on various factors such as the content’s license, terms of use, and any applicable copyright laws. It is essential to review and comply with the legal requirements and obtain necessary permissions or licenses before displaying external content within an application.
Q: Can I monetize or generate revenue by displaying content within my application?
A: Whether you can monetize or generate revenue by displaying content within your application depends on the terms and conditions set by the website from where the content is being loaded. Some websites may allow commercial use of their content, while others may have restrictions or require licensing agreements. It is crucial to review and comply with the website owner’s guidelines and terms regarding monetization.
Q: Is it possible to keep the content within the application up-to-date automatically?
A: Yes, it is possible to keep the content within the application up-to-date automatically by regularly fetching the latest content from the website. This can be achieved by utilizing APIs, content syndication, or other automated methods. However, it is essential to respect the website’s terms of use and not overload their servers with excessive requests.
Q: What are some examples of applications that display content from websites?
A: There are various examples of applications that display content from websites, such as news aggregators, social media clients, RSS readers, weather apps, stock market trackers, and many more. These applications fetch content from relevant websites and present it to users in a consolidated and user-friendly manner.
